コンテンツにスキップ

「Touchegg」の版間の差分

提供: ArchWiki
削除された内容 追加された内容
Kgx (トーク | 投稿記録)
Gnome Shell: ノートを翻訳して追加
Kgx (トーク | 投稿記録)
設定: startx コマンドの場合を翻訳して追加
7行目: 7行目:
GUI 設定には [[AUR|AUR]] の {{AUR|touchegg-gce-git}} [https://github.com/Raffarti/Touchegg-gce] が利用可能です。
GUI 設定には [[AUR|AUR]] の {{AUR|touchegg-gce-git}} [https://github.com/Raffarti/Touchegg-gce] が利用可能です。


== ログイン時に開始 ==
==設定==
{{ic|$HOME/.config/touchegg/touchegg.conf}} が設定ファイルです。


デーモンは systemd : {{ic|systemctl enable touchegg.service}} で起動します。
これは多数のジェスチャが定義された単純な XML ファイルです。現段階では <code>TAP_AND_HOLD</code>、<code>PINCH</code> と <code>ROTATE</code> は使えません。
クライアントはwmからロードできます。

全てのトリガーのリストは [https://github.com/JoseExposito/touchegg/wiki/All-gestures-supported-by-Touch%C3%A9gg 公式サイトの Wiki にあります]。

全てのアクションのリストは [https://github.com/JoseExposito/touchegg/wiki/All-actions-supported-by-Touch%C3%A9gg 公式サイトの Wiki にあります]。


====Gnome Shell====
====Gnome Shell====
42行目: 38行目:


{{note| {{ic|gnome-session-properties}} が {{ic|gnome 3.12}} から削除されました。現在、 {{aur|gnome-session-properties}} を [[AUR]] からインストールできます。詳細については、こちらを参照して下さい [https://bbs.archlinux.org/viewtopic.php?id&#61;180282 BBSスレッド] }}
{{note| {{ic|gnome-session-properties}} が {{ic|gnome 3.12}} から削除されました。現在、 {{aur|gnome-session-properties}} を [[AUR]] からインストールできます。詳細については、こちらを参照して下さい [https://bbs.archlinux.org/viewtopic.php?id&#61;180282 BBSスレッド] }}

==== startx コマンドの場合 ====
[[.xprofile]] は変更できます。

{{hc|~/.xprofile|
touchegg &}}

2021年3月1日 (月) 21:25時点における版

Touchegg はウィンドウマネージャーにマルチタッチサポートをバックグランドで提供するマルチタッチジェスチャープログラムです。

インストール

基本パッケージは AURtoucheggAUR です。

GUI 設定には AURtouchegg-gce-gitAUR [1] が利用可能です。

ログイン時に開始

デーモンは systemd : systemctl enable touchegg.service で起動します。 クライアントはwmからロードできます。

Gnome Shell

これはとても簡単に基本機能を与えます。うまくいけば完全なるアプリケーションサポートのためにアップデートできます。

~/.config/touchegg/touchegg.conf を編集し、以下のラインを追加します:

<gesture type="DRAG" fingers="1" direction="ALL">
            <action type="DRAG_AND_DROP">BUTTON=1</action>
        </gesture>

そしてこれを編集します:

<gesture type="DRAG" fingers="2" direction="ALL">
            <action type="SCROLL">SPEED=7:INVERTED=true</action>
        </gesture>

それから touchegg がログイン時に開始するようにします:

  1. alt-f2 を押下します。
  2. gnome-session-properties と入力します。
  3. add を押下します。
  4. ラベル欄は "Command" タイプは toucheggです。"Name" と "Label" を適当に選択します。
  5. OK を押下します。
ノート gnome-session-propertiesgnome 3.12 から削除されました。現在、 gnome-session-propertiesAURAUR からインストールできます。詳細については、こちらを参照して下さい BBSスレッド

startx コマンドの場合

.xprofile は変更できます。

~/.xprofile
touchegg &